Experience the delicate, flaky perfection of Cape Capensis Baked with Herbs Hake, a simple yet flavorful recipe that's perfect for seafood lovers. This dish features tender Cape Capensis hake fillets marinated in a fragrant mixture of fresh parsley, dill, thyme, garlic, lemon juice, and olive oil, enhanced with a touch of paprika for a subtle smoky kick. Baked alongside sweet cherry tomatoes and caramelized red onion, the fish comes together in just 20 minutes of cook time, making it a quick and healthy dinner option. With its vibrant, herbaceous flavors and a beautifully moist texture, this baked hake is perfect served with steamed vegetables, rice, or a crisp green salad. Easy to prepare and naturally rich in omega-3s, it's a wholesome choice for weeknight meals or casual entertaining.

π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

12 items
  • 4 pieces Cape Capensis hake fillets
  • 3 tablespoons Fresh parsley
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h dill
  • 3 pieces Garlic cloves
  • 3 tablespoons Lemon juice
  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on Paprika
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on Fresh thyme
  • 250 grams Cherry tomatoes
  • 1 large Red onion

πŸ“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 200Β°C (400Β°F). Line a baking dish with parchment paper.

2

Place the Cape Capensis hake fillets in the prepared baking dish, skin-side down if applicable.

3

In a small bowl, mix together the parsley, dill, garlic (minced), thyme, paprika, salt, black pepper, olive oil, and lemon juice to create a herb marinade.

4

Generously spread the herb marinade over the hake fillets, ensuring they are evenly coated.

5

Slice the cherry tomatoes in half and thinly slice the red onion. Arrange them around the fish in the baking dish.

6

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il to prevent the fish from drying out.

7

Bake in the preheated oven for 15 minutes, then remove the foil and bake for an additional 5 minutes to allow the fish to lightly brown.

8

Check that the hake is cooked throughβ€”it should flake easily with a fork and have a white, opaque appearance.

9

Remove from the oven and let rest for 2–3 minutes. Serve warm with your favorite sides, such as steamed vegetables, rice, or a fresh green salad.
